About Adenza
Adenza provides customers with end-to-end trading, treasury, risk management, and regulatory compliance platforms which can be delivered on-premise or on-cloud. We enable the world’s largest financial institutions to consolidate and streamline their operations with front-to-back solutions integrated with data management and reporting. We give them a single source of truth across the business.

With headquarters in London and New York, Adenza has more than 60,000 users across global, central, and regional banks, broker-dealers, insurers, asset managers, pension funds, hedge funds, stock exchanges and clearing houses, securities services providers, and corporates.
